56-29-102. Corporations covered by this chapter.

Any corporation not for profit organized under the former General Welfare Corporation Act, or under former title 48, chapters 1-14 [repealed] for the purpose of establishing, maintaining and operating a nonprofit hospital service corporation and of providing medical benefits, whereby hospital service may be provided by a hospital or group of hospitals with which the corporation has a contract for that purpose and whereby the corporation may provide cash indemnity for medical expense, to such of the public as become subscribers to the corporation under a contract that entitles each subscriber to certain hospital care and to certain cash indemnity benefits for medical expense, shall be governed by this chapter.

[Acts 1949, ch. 234, § 1; C. Supp. 1950, § 4186.43 (Williams, § 4186.46); impl. am. Acts 1968, ch. 523, § 1 (17.06); T.C.A. (orig. ed.), § 56-3102.]
